To thrive as an International Policy Analyst, a solid background in international relations, political science, or economics, along with strong research and analytical skills, is essential. Familiarity with data analysis tools (such as SPSS or Stata), policy management software, and advanced Microsoft Excel is often highly beneficial. Outstanding communication, cross-cultural awareness, and critical thinking abilities set top candidates apart. These competencies are crucial for accurately analyzing global policy trends, producing insightful reports, and collaborating with diverse teams to influence decision-making.
